I bought this bass because I think Ibanez makes the best basses in the world for people with smaller hands. The soundgear basses always seem to have nice slender necks,great action, and all of the tonal options needed. I have owned the SR500 for 5 plus years now? I bought the 400 because it is lighter. It doesnt have the Bartolini setup but it still sounds great. I am confused with the tone knobs. Mine is a 4 knob setup with a stacked knob. Both the bass and the mid knob seem to work as a bass boost. I get great tone but not as user friendly as the 5 knob setup.I am not much for needing alot of tonal options. I basically need a standard deep tone with a little mids and highs to hear my attack. Then I like to be able to dump a little mid and boost the bass for slapping. My SR500 does this easy. My 4 knob 400 is giving me a little trouble figuring it out. I will play this 400 bass 90% of the time because of its weight. The biggest difference in overall feel between the 500 and 400 is the 400 feels much brighter all over. Must be the maple. I love it. The newer 400s advertise the 5 button tone control. I wish mine had that option.The pickups are rounded and dont leave much of a thumb rest but you could add one if needed. I find just enough of the edge to get by. If you want great tone,thin necks,great prices buy Ibanez soundgear basses.

This bass is awesome the onboard eq system offers sooooooo many possibilties with tone, the slap to finger style knob offers a huge variety of sounds and the pickup blender sounds good in all over. This bass also plays AWSOME! super thin neck and body ready to play right out of the box. The only downside is on mine the eq knobs can make some noise when youre turning them but NOT every one has this problem. In addition, the pickups are curved so the place where on might rest a thumb isnt very wide. I have no issue but if you like a nice big place to rest your thumb you might have to bring the pickup a little higher than normal. Easy fix tho no big deal. Overall amazing instrument and it loves effects so youre pedals will be satisfied as well :)

I've owned my SR400QM for a couple of years now, and I have been very happy with it. It has a wide range of tones available, thanks to active circuitry and better than average controls. I have no trouble going from a nice heavy bottom end to a midrange growl to a bright tone that slaps better than most other basses I've tried. My only complaints about the bass were that it had Elixir strings put on at the factory, and its neck is a little unstable. The strings did sound pretty good for a long time, but within a couple of weeks the "space-age polymer" started to fray and they looked like they needed a shave. I eventually changed them out for a set of Rotosound FM66's (loosening the truss rod accordingly), which really sound great on the bass. The lower tension also helped stabilize the neck a bit.All in all I love this bass, and I think its a great value. It probably won't replace your P or J, but it has it's own cool vibe and is extremely versatile. The super thin neck and light weight make it effortless to play as well.

I bought this bass site unseen a few weeks ago. I was really unimpressed with this bass. I unpacked it and picked it up. The neck on this bass was puny, it felt really light and overall felt like a child's toy. I bought this bass based on some of the reviews here but did not see what others see in this bass. I do a lot of recording at home and plugged this in and was not impressed buy the sound quality. What was annoying about this particular bass was that you had to fiddle with the eq settings, and choose between slap or fingered finger style settings. I found that each time I was recording a song, I had to waste time dialing in a very thin tone. I would not recommend buying this bass because it does not live up to the hype. Great for starting out or for people who don't get what good bass tone should sound like.
